Education Minister ends ‘misunderstanding’ between MP Afenyo Markin and UEW VC

The Minister of Education,Dr. Mathew Opoku Prempeh has brought together the Vice Chancellor of the University of Education, Rev. Prof. Afful-Broni and Member of Parliament for Winneba, Hon Alexander Afenyo-Markin .

The two were invited by the Minister to settle an alleged misunderstanding between the two ,which supposedly led to the recent disturbances which led to Closure of the University.

The recent erratic palpitations at the University of Education, Winneba (UEW) was becoming a source of worry to many stakeholders and the Ministry of Education.

The meeting was held in the Office of the Minister on Friday,March 15,2019.

The Minister invited the  Vice Chancellor of the university, Rev. Prof. Afful-Broni, the chairman of UEW’s council, Prof. Emmanuel Nicholas Abakah, the Member of Parliament for Winneba, Hon Alexander Afenyo-Markin, some other staffers of UEW and concerned members of the community for a meeting to address the situation that was threatening the stability of peace at UEW.

During the meeting,differences were addressed and settled with an agreement to collaborate in addressing issues that affect stakeholders directly and indirectly.
